Overview

CVE-2020-16944 is a high-severity vulnerability affecting microsoft sharepoint_enterprise_server. It was published on October 16, 2020 and has a CVSS 3.1 base score of 8.7 (HIGH).

This vulnerability has a CVSS 3.1 base score of 8.7, rated HIGH. It can be exploited remotely over the network. Some level of privileges is required for exploitation.

Technical Description

<p>This vulnerability is caused when SharePoint Server does not properly sanitize a specially crafted request to an affected SharePoint server.</p>

<p>An authenticated attacker could exploit this vulnerability by sending a specially crafted request to an affected SharePoint server. The attacker who successfully exploited this vulnerability could then perform cross-site scripting attacks on affected systems and run script in the security context of the current user. These attacks could allow the attacker to read content that the attacker is not authorized to read, use the victim's identity to take actions on the SharePoint site on behalf of the victim, such as change permissions, delete content, steal sensitive information (such as browser cookies) and inject malicious content in the browser of the victim.</p>

<p>For this vulnerability to be exploited, a user must click a specially crafted URL that takes the user to a targeted SharePoint Web App site.</p>

Remediation

Check the references section for vendor advisories and patches from microsoft. Update sharepoint_enterprise_server to the latest patched version. If immediate patching is not possible, review the CVSS vector to understand the attack surface and apply compensating controls such as network segmentation or access restrictions.
